FRONT SHOCK ABSORBER REMOVAL

Tech Tips


  • Use the same procedure for the RH side and LH side.

  • The following procedure is for the LH side.

PROCEDURE


  1. REMOVE FRONT WHEEL

  3. SEPARATE FRONT STABILIZER LINK ASSEMBLY


    1. B006YZM

      Remove the nut and separate the front stabilizer link assembly from the front shock absorber assembly.

      Note

      Do not damage the boot of the ball joint.

      Tech Tips

      If the ball joint turns together with the nut, use a 6 mm hexagon socket wrench to hold the stud bolt.

  4. SEPARATE FRONT SPEED SENSOR


    1. B006XAH

      Remove the bolt, disengage the clamp and separate the front speed sensor and front flexible hose from the front shock absorber assembly.

      Note

      Be sure to separate the front speed sensor and front flexible hose from the front shock absorber assembly completely.

  5. LOOSEN FRONT SUPPORT TO FRONT SHOCK ABSORBER NUT


    1. B006Z5R

      Loosen the front support to front shock absorber nut.

      CAUTION:


      • Only loosen the front support to front shock absorber nut if the front shock absorber with coil spring needs to be disassembled.

      • Only loosen the front support to front shock absorber nut, do not remove it.

      • If the front support to front shock absorber nut is removed with the front coil spring under tension, components of the front shock absorber with coil spring may fly off.

  6. REMOVE FRONT SHOCK ABSORBER WITH COIL SPRING


    1. B006X0CC01
      *a Wooden Block
      *b Jack
      B006Z38 Front of the Vehicle
      B006Y8C Wooden Block Placement Location

      Support the front lower No. 1 suspension arm sub-assembly using a jack and wooden block.

      Note

      Keep the front lower No. 1 suspension arm sub-assembly supported until installation of the front shock absorber with coil spring is complete.

    2. B006Y47

      Remove the 2 bolts and 2 nuts, and separate the front shock absorber with coil spring (lower side) from the steering knuckle.

      Note


      • When removing the nuts, keep the bolts from rotating.

      • Use wire or an equivalent tool to hang the separated steering knuckle.

    3. B00705S

      Remove the 3 nuts and front shock absorber with coil spring.

  7. REMOVE FRONT SUPPORT TO FRONT SHOCK ABSORBER NUT


    1. B006WZ6N04

      Secure SST in a vise.

      SST
      09727-00051
      09727-30022   ( 09727-00010, 09727-00031 )
    2. Attach the hooks of each SST arm across the diameter of the coil spring.

      CAUTION:


      • B006WY9

        Make sure that the hooks are securely attached to the coil spring.

      • If a hook disengages from the coil spring, the coil spring may fly out, resulting in injury.

      • B006XOV

        Make sure that the hooks of the upper and lower SST arms are attached to the coil spring so that the distance between the hooks is as large as possible.

      • If a hook disengages from the coil spring, the coil spring may fly out, resulting in injury.

      • B0070SR

        Make sure that the arms of SST are parallel and the number of coils between the arms is the same on each side.

      • If a hook disengages from the coil spring, the coil spring may fly out, resulting in injury.

    3. Install the stopper pins to the hooks of SST.

      CAUTION:


      • Make sure that the stopper pins are installed securely.

      • If a hook disengages from the coil spring, the coil spring may fly out, resulting in injury.

      B0071FB
    4. B006X3JC01
      *a Vehicle Nut

      Install SST and 2 vehicle nuts to the upper support as shown in the illustration.

      SST
      09727-30022   ( 09727-00090, 09727-00100 )
    5. Using SST, compress the coil spring.

      CAUTION:


      • B006ZAV

        If the coil spring starts to bow out while using SST, stop immediately and reattach SST correctly.

      • If a hook disengages from the coil spring, the coil spring may fly out, resulting in injury.

      • B006Y65

        Do not compress the coil spring to the point where the coils touch each other.

      • If a hook disengages from the coil spring, the coil spring may fly out, resulting in injury.

      • B006XFY

        Do not use an impact wrench.

      • If an impact wrench is used, the threads of SST may be damaged, or sudden compression of the coil spring may cause a hook to disengage and the coil spring to fly out, resulting in injury.

      • B0070OUN01

        If a stopper pin touches the coil spring while using SST, remove the stopper pin and continue with the procedure.

      • If a stopper pin is removed, install a coil spring stopper belt as shown in the illustration.

      • If a hook disengages from the coil spring, the coil spring may fly out, resulting in injury.

      SST
      09727-00110
    6. Check that the coil spring has become detached, and then remove the front support to front shock absorber nut.

      CAUTION:


      • Do not remove the front support to front shock absorber nut while the coil spring is under tension.

      • If the front support to front shock absorber nut is removed with the coil spring under tension, components of the front shock absorber with coil spring may fly off, resulting in injury.

  8. REMOVE FRONT SUSPENSION SUPPORT SUB-ASSEMBLY


    1. Remove the front suspension support sub-assembly from the front shock absorber assembly.

  9. REMOVE STRUT MOUNTING BEARING WITH DUST COVER


    1. B0071EVC01
      *1 Front No. 1 Shock Absorber Dust Cover
      *a Claw

      Disengage the end of the front No. 1 shock absorber dust cover from the claws of the front shock absorber assembly.

    2. Remove the strut mounting bearing with dust cover from the front shock absorber assembly.

  10. REMOVE FRONT UPPER COIL SPRING INSULATOR


    1. B006ZQ5

      Remove the front upper coil spring insulator from the strut mounting bearing.

  11. REMOVE STRUT MOUNTING BEARING


    1. B0070YW

      Disengage the top end of the front No. 1 shock absorber dust cover to remove the strut mounting bearing from the shock absorber dust cover.

  12. REMOVE FRONT COIL SPRING


    1. Remove the front coil spring and SST.

      Note

      Do not use an impact wrench. It will damage SST.

  13. REMOVE FRONT SPRING BUMPER


    1. Remove the front spring bumper from the front shock absorber assembly.

  14. REMOVE FRONT LOWER COIL SPRING INSULATOR


    1. Remove the front lower coil spring insulator from the front shock absorber assembly.

  15. REMOVE SUSPENSION TOWER DAMPER


    1. B006ZV7

      Remove the bolt and suspension tower damper from the front shock absorber assembly.
